1 GND Signal ground GND
2 RST RESET
Pin received 200ms low to reset the whole module.
If you do not use, can be suspended.
Note: The module is powered automatic reset, it is
recommended that connect the MCU IO port, reset the MCU
control module in a particular case.
3 ISP Update pin
This pin to ground to the module power module can be
upgraded.
If you do not use, can be suspended.
4 RXD
Module data is
received
Data receiving end of the module, TTL level 5V or 3.3V
microcontroller
5 TXD Module data
transmission
Data transmission end of the module, TTL level can be
connected to 5V or 3.3V microcontroller
6 CFG
Serial ports
Configuration pins
Low, you can use the serial port module configuration.
Normal working hours left floating or tied HIGH.
Note: give the power module, and then pulled down the CFG
pin to enter the serial configuration state.
7 LD2
Network data
instructions
Network data indicator LED connected to VCC, without the
current limiting resistance (module existing)
8 LD1
Network connection
status indicator
Network connection status indicator LED connected to VCC,
without the current limiting resistor (module already)
9 2V5
PHY chip
Output voltage
PHY chip to control the voltage output, access networks
transformer center tap
10 RX+ Received signal + Receive Data+
11
RX- Received signal - Receive Data -
12 TX+ Transceiver Data+ Transceiver Data+
13 TX- Transceiver Data - Transceiver Data-
14 RTS the alternate pin Can be used as RS485 enable pin
15 CTS the alternate pin Can be used as a network connection status indicator pin
16 VCC Power supply Power supply : 3.3V @ 200mA
